Liverpool to join race to sign Toulouse defender Serge Aurier?

Liverpool are ready to compete with Arsenal for Toulouse defender Serge Aurier, with the Anfield club hoping to launch a bid this week, according to reports.

Liverpool have reportedly joined the race for the signature of Toulouse right-back Serge Aurier in this summer's transfer window.

Arsenal have also been consistently linked with the Ivory Coast international, who is likely to appear at the World Cup in Brazil.

It has been suggested that Aurier is seen as a long-term replacement for Bacary Sagna, but it is understood that Arsene Wenger is yet to make a move for the 21-year-old.

Now, it looks like Liverpool are ready to take advantage of Arsenal's hesitation and launch a bid for the defender, who is thought to be worth around £7m.

Rodgers has identified targets to strengthen his defence at Anfield, with the club also hopeful of completing the signing of Sevilla's Alberto Moreno in the coming weeks.
